Why stop a therapy that has dropped you breathing interruptions from 33 an hour to 3.3?

That's totally irrational.

No matter how you feel now -- your body was much worse off physically when you stopped breathing ever two minute the on CPAP.

You fatigue may be the result of benzo abuse -- caused by the doctor's who prescribed you Klonopin. It takes a long time to recover from that -- http://www.benzo.org.uk/manual/index.htm.

It may be caused by other things.

Are you sure you machine is set up in fixed pressure mode at 8? Are you sure its not minimum 4, maximum 8?

I would set up the machine at minimum = maximum = 8, and drop EPR to 1 or 0. Pressure changes disrupt sleep for some people - if you're one of those, you have to make sure you get stable pressure.

Stopping CPAP won't make you healthier - on the contrary. Except for anger and disappointment at not feeling well with CPAP -- do you have other reasons for stopping?

Spirit,

I have been on CPAP for about 3 months now... yes in texas heat! The one major question I have is how often are you cleaning your mask? I fond I have to clean mask everyday and sometimes once in my sleep. My natural oils make me create leaks. I dont mean take the mask apart clean. Get you some unscented baby wipes and give it a good wipe down. It takes about 1 minute. But when each time you put it on, it is like a new mask

Oh yes, dont give up! For what it is worth, I am like a new man after 3 months!
